I have a very nice watch. I honestly can't recall if it was my grandmother's or eldest aunt's. But I think it was Grandmother's. And I have my baby ring. Don't think the literal value is much, but it is cool.

But, I will never own anything more awesome than Mom's wedding set. After she passed, I wore the set all the time for about a year. And, this is so shitty, but I can't recall why I stopped wearing them. I did, but don't recall why.

So, I have them on tonight, as I want to wear them tomorrow when I become God Mother to Lainey. I just would like to have a part of Mom there. Just because. Yeah, I am really sentimental! Probably to a fault.

So, do you have any jewelry that means something special?
